I Brought My Husband a Surprise Dinner at Work and Found Out He Had Been Dismissed Three Months Earlier

When I surprised my husband at work with his favorite lunch, I discovered he hadn’t been employed there for months. Little did I know, this revelation would unravel the fabric of our 20-year marriage and set me on a path I never could have imagined.

I packed Jonathan’s favorite lunch — lasagna, garlic bread, and tiramisu. The security guard at his office building looked at me funny when I asked for Jonathan.

“Ma’am, Jonathan hasn’t worked here in over three months,” he said.

My stomach dropped. “What? That can’t be right. He’s here every day.”

The guard shook his head. “Sorry, but he was laid off. You might want to talk to him about it.”

I left, my cheeks burning. What the hell was going on?

The next morning, I watched Jonathan get ready for “work” as usual. Once he left, I called a taxi. We tailed him to a run-down part of town, where he entered a small café and met with several women.

That night, I confronted Jonathan with photos. He admitted he quit his job to follow his dream of directing a play, using $50,000 of our savings. Devastated, I gave him an ultimatum: cancel the play or we get divorced. He chose the play.

A few months later, I filed for divorce, fought to reclaim my savings, and focused on my children and future. Jonathan’s play flopped, but I knew I’d made the right choice, ready to embrace new adventures ahead.
